Feldman Sets School Record with 20 Rebounds But Saints Winning Streak Ends

St. Louis – Despite a school-record 20 rebounds by Karlee Feldman, the Maryville women's basketball team saw its six-game winning streak come to an end at the hands of Indianapolis. The Greyhounds halted the Saints 80-55. Feldman's 20 boards snapped the previous program record of 19 set by Abby Monis Nov. 23, 2019, against Upper Iowa. Feldman had a double-double as she scored 14 points, while Carsyn Fearday led the Saints with 17 points.
 
Indianapolis recap
The Saints tied the game at 8-8 after two free throws by Gracie Stugart. The Greyhounds scored eight straight points before Feldman tallied at the end of the first quarter. Down 18-10 early in the second, Stugart sank a jumper and a 3-pointer to pull the Saints to within 18-15. However, UIndy reeled off a 19-2 burst to extend its advantage. Feldman converted back-to-back layups but the Saints trailed at halftime.
 
Still trailing by more than 20 points, Maryville used an 11-0 run that bridged the end of the third quarter and the start of the fourth. Fearday had a layup and free throw, followed by one at the line by Feldman. Antoinette Mussorici drained a 3-pointer, and Fearday hit consecutive jumpers to pull the Saints to within 60-47 with 7:34 to play. UIndy scored seven of the next 10 points to seal the victory
